Kalita Wave

The Kalita Wave dripper is a pour-over, similar to a Chemex or V60, which makes for a clean cup of coffee. This contrasts with the robust profile of full-immersion brews, such as the French Press, for example.

Yet while similar to the Chemex or V60, the Kalita Wave has a markedly different extraction configuration. Rather than water dripping through a singular hole, it features a flat bottom with three extraction holes. This eliminates any channelling of water in the coffee bed, resulting in an extremely crisp cup. The dripper also has minimal contact with the filter, allowing for consistency in temperature and an even dispersion of water.

Brewing time: 2 minutes

What you will need:

  • Kalita Wave dripper
  • Kalita Wave paper filter (size 185)
  • coffee
  • server or a bigger cup (aprox. 300 ml)
  • boiling water (preferably filtered)
  • timer
  • scale
  • grinder (if you want to grind the coffee by yourself)

INSTRUCTIONS:

STEP 1: Place the filter paper in your Kalita Wave and give it a quick rinse to heat up your vessel and to get rid of any paper flavours that may be there. Remember to pour out the water before brewing. 

STEP 2: Heat your water to boiling temperature (preferably 96-98°C).

STEP 3: Grind coffee coarsely, from scale 1-10, use grind size of 8 (you can skip this step, if using pre-ground coffee).

STEP 4: Place ground coffee in the filter evenly to form a flat bed. For this recipe, we are going to brew with a ratio of 22 grams of coffee to 300 grams of water.

STEP 5: Place your Kalita Wave and server onto your scales and tare them off, letting you weigh out the water as you’re brewing.

STEP 6: Start your timer, then slowly introduce 66g of water onto the coffee bed and ensure all coffee grounds are wet and watch it bloom.

STEP 7: In 45 seconds, the blooming process should be done. You may start the second pour of 300 grams of water within the next 1 min 15 sec making bigger and smaller circles. Try to avoid pouring on the paper filter. Try to pour 360 grams of water in exactly 2 minutes. 

STEP 8: After pouring 360 grams of water, turn the dripper clockwise a few times thus leveling the coffee grounds evenly and ensuring even extractio.

STEP 9: Wait till all of the water has been filtered out, take off the dripper and enjoy!
